What does it mean to be a Registered Agent?

A registered agent is a appointed entity or entity appointed to accept legal documents on behalf of a company. This can include important notifications such as lawsuits, tax documents, and regulatory correspondence. The role of a designee is crucial as they ensure that the company stays in accordance with local laws and is informed of any legal issues in a swift manner.

Organizations, especially limited liability companies (LLCs) and business entities, are required by statute to have a designated agent in the jurisdiction where they are formed and occasionally in states where they operate. The designated individual must have a real-world location in that state, which serves as the primary contact. This condition helps maintain accountability and provides a consistent way for the government to correspond with the business.

Designated agents can be private citizens or business service firms that provide legal representation services. Many businesses opt to hire a professional agent for simplicity and to ensure compliance with legal requirements. These providers can vary in cost and offerings, making it essential for companies to consider the best possibilities when choosing the best registered agent service for their specific situation.

Expenses Analysis of Designated Agent Services

When considering registered agent services, companies often search for the best mix of affordability and service quality. Prices can change significantly depending on the level of service provided. Basic services may start as low as 50 to $100 dollars per year, while more comprehensive packages offered by professional registered agents can cost upwards of $300 to $500 dollars annually. It's important for entrepreneurs to review what is included in each service level, as the most affordable options may not provide the necessary features such as compliance monitoring or reliable customer support.

Many registered agent companies offer structured fee structures based on offerings and additional features like document retrieval or alerts for compliance deadlines. As an example, a nationwide registered agent service may charge more for their extensive coverage and reliable record-keeping system. Additionally, companies that provide digital services might feature more affordable costs due to reduced overhead. Comparing designated agent services requires looking at both the pricing and the services included, ensuring that companies choose a registered agent that meets their particular needs.

One more factor affecting registered agent cost is the type of entity. LLCs and companies might face different fee structures, given the legal requirements associated with each type. Moreover, while some registered agents market themselves as affordable choices, additional costs could emerge over time, such as extra charges for annual report filings or adding new states. Therefore, thorough research into registered agent feedback and ratings can provide valuable insights into which service offers the best value for the cost in the long run.

Usual Agent Responsibilities

A designated agent plays a vital role in maintaining a company's compliance with government requirements. One of the primary responsibilities is to accept legal documents on behalf of the company, such as legal actions, subpoenas, and other official notices. This ensures that the business is updated of any lawsuits in a prompt manner, allowing it to react appropriately. Having a qualified registered agent ensures that these important documents are managed correctly and safely.

Furthermore, registered agents are responsible for maintaining precise records and updates related to the business's standing. This includes informing the business of forthcoming filing due dates for annual reports and other mandatory documents. By helping businesses remain structured and cognizant of their compliance obligations, registered agents contribute significantly to the efficient operation of the business.

Another key responsibility of a registered agent involves ensuring that the business maintains a registered physical address. This address must be a physical location within the state of registration and must be available during regular office hours. Having a reliable address reduces the risk of missing important notices and helps maintain the company's good status with state authorities.
